10 decisions the Board of Supervisors took about Brazil Ave, between 1909 and 1965, read from its own minutes and each linked to the scanned page; most of them in the 1920s; often about paving and grading, sewers, fire stations.

Decade by decade

Newest first. Each decade shows its most notable decision; the line opens the scanned page.

  1. 1960s1
    Map approved to extend Brazil Avenue to John McLaren Park · 1965
  2. 1950s1
    Prague Street to be improved with $7,000 in city aid · 1957
  3. 1940s1
    William Davidson pays $904.65 to clear a Paris Street lien · 1940
  4. 1920s3
    Moscow Street to be paved between Persia and Brazil avenues · 1924
  5. 1910s2
    Sewers ordered on Edinburgh Street and Brazil Avenue · 1910
  6. 1900s2
    Emily Smith's land accepted for a new fire engine house · 1909
